The institutional adoption wave is driving demand for enterprise-grade security solutions. Financial institutions entering the crypto space require multi-signature wallet implementations, cold storage solutions with geographic distribution, and advanced key management systems. The security requirements extend beyond traditional cybersecurity measures to include specialized hardware security modules, quantum-resistant cryptography preparations, and sophisticated transaction monitoring systems.
Regulatory compliance frameworks are evolving rapidly to address these new security challenges. Institutions must implement know-your-transaction (KYT) protocols, anti-money laundering (AML) monitoring specifically designed for blockchain transactions, and real-time risk assessment tools capable of handling the unique characteristics of digital assets. The convergence of traditional financial regulations with blockchain technology requirements creates complex security implementation scenarios.
Network security considerations have expanded to include blockchain-specific threats. Institutions must protect against 51% attacks, smart contract vulnerabilities, and cross-chain bridge security risks. The infrastructure must also address traditional threats like DDoS attacks, which could disrupt trading operations during critical Fed announcement periods when market volatility typically increases.
Data security and privacy concerns take on new dimensions in blockchain environments. While blockchain technology offers transparency, institutional traders require privacy solutions that protect their trading strategies. Zero-knowledge proof implementations, secure multi-party computation, and privacy-preserving analytics are becoming essential components of institutional crypto security stacks.

Incident response planning requires specialized knowledge for crypto security incidents. Traditional incident response protocols must be adapted to address blockchain-specific scenarios, including smart contract exploits, key compromise events, and exchange security breaches. Response teams need training in blockchain forensic analysis and recovery procedures unique to digital assets.
Third-party risk management becomes increasingly critical as institutions rely on multiple service providers for custody, trading, and security services. Vendor security assessments must now include evaluations of blockchain expertise, smart contract audit capabilities, and experience with digital asset security incidents.
The integration of traditional banking systems with blockchain networks introduces new attack surfaces. Security architects must address API security between legacy systems and blockchain interfaces, secure oracle implementations for price feeds, and protect the integration points between traditional finance and decentralized finance protocols.
